Set Amplitude Correction Frequency Interpolatio n
[ :SENSe] :CORRection :CSET[1]I21314 :X :SPACing
LINearILOGarithmi
Sets the frequency interpolation to linear or logarithmic for the
specified correction set .
Remarks:
Logarithmic frequency scale corrections are linearl y
interpolated between correction points with respect t o
the logarithm of the frequency. Linear frequency scale
corrections are interpolated along straight lines ,
connecting adjacent points on a linear scale.

Perform Amplitude Correction
[ :SENSe] :CORRection :CSET[1]I21314[ :STATe] OFFION101 1
[ :SENSe] :CORRection :CSET[1]I21314[ :STATe] ?
Turns the amplitude correction function on or off for the given set .
NOTE
[ :
SENSe ] : CORRection : CSET :ALL [ : STATe ] must be on for this comman d
to function .
Factory Preset
and *RST:
Of f
Remarks :
CSET number equivalents to front panel access
definitions are as follows :
CSET1 is Antenn a
CSET2 is Cabl e
CSET3 is Other
CSET4 is User
